WebDec 14, 2024 · Figure 1 shows the proposed cavity-based photonic crystal optical modulator integrated with micro-hotplate on SOI platform. The proposed device consists of a cavity inside the photonic crystal and an insulation layer of silicon dioxide is provided of thickness 0.15 µm.
